> > Then would it be time for some sort of "rollback" utility,
> > so if "yum update something" breaks, maybe  : yum --rollback something
> 
> That's been discussed before. It's fantastically hard to do, short of
> snapshotting the whole system.

Actually, some support for this was written into RPM in 4.6, and then
taken out in 4.7. :) Mostly because no-one really used it, contributory
factor being that it did have bugs related to the above.

Mandriva implemented some support into urpmi, with the same result - it
did, more or less, actually work, but had bugs and very few people
actually used it (may have been a communication issue).
